19"""This module is the interface for gravitational wave source catalogs. It is 

20responsible for : 

21 - registering new catalog implementations as plugins 

22 - loading detections and source posterior samples 

23""" 

24import importlib 

25from abc import ABC 

26from abc import abstractmethod 

27from dataclasses import dataclass 

28from typing import List 

29from typing import Optional 

30from typing import Union 

31 

32import pandas as pd 

33 

34from .custom_logging import UtilsLogs # noqa: F401 

35from .monitoring import UtilsMonitoring # noqa: F401 

36 

37 

38class GWCatalogType: 

39 """GW catalog implementation. 

40 

41 New implementations can be added as an attribute using the register 

42 method of the GWCatalogs class. 

43 """ 

44 

45 @dataclass 

46 class GWCatalogPlugin: 

47 """Store information to load a plugin implementing the GW catalog. 

48 

49 The stored information is: 

50 - the module name 

51 - the class name 

52 """ 

53 

54 module_name: str 

55 class_name: str 

56 

57 MBH = GWCatalogPlugin("lisacattools.plugins.mbh", "MbhCatalogs") 

58 UCB = GWCatalogPlugin("lisacattools.plugins.ucb", "UcbCatalogs") 

59 

60

213class GWCatalogs(ABC): 

214 """Interface fo handling time-evolving GW catalogs""" 

215 

216 @classmethod 

217 def __subclasshook__(cls, subclass): 

218 return ( 

219 hasattr(subclass, "metadata") 

220 and callable(subclass.metadata) 

221 and hasattr(subclass, "count") 

222 and callable(subclass.count) 

223 and hasattr(subclass, "files") 

224 and callable(subclass.files) 

225 and hasattr(subclass, "get_catalogs_name") 

226 and callable(subclass.get_catalogs_name) 

227 and hasattr(subclass, "get_first_catalog") 

228 and callable(subclass.get_first_catalog) 

229 and hasattr(subclass, "get_last_catalog") 

230 and callable(subclass.get_last_catalog) 

231 and hasattr(subclass, "get_catalog") 

232 and callable(subclass.get_catalog) 

233 and hasattr(subclass, "get_catalog_by") 

234 and callable(subclass.get_catalog_by) 

235 and hasattr(subclass, "get_lineage") 

236 and callable(subclass.get_lineage) 

237 and hasattr(subclass, "get_lineage_data") 

238 and callable(subclass.get_lineage_data) 

239 or NotImplemented 

240 ) 

241 

242 @staticmethod 

243 def register(type: str, nodule_name: str, class_name: str): 

244 """Register a new implementation of GWCatalogs 

245 

246 Args: 

247 type (str): name of the implementation 

248 nodule_name (str): nodule name where the implementation is done 

249 class_name (str): class name of the implementation 

250 """ 

251 setattr( 

252 GWCatalogType, 

253 str(type), 

254 GWCatalogType.GWCatalogPlugin(nodule_name, class_name), 

255 ) 

256 

257 @staticmethod 

258 def create( 

259 type: GWCatalogType.GWCatalogPlugin, 

260 directory: str, 

261 accepted_pattern: Optional[str] = None, 

262 rejected_pattern: Optional[str] = None, 

263 *args, 

264 **kwargs 

265 ) -> "GWCatalogs": 

266 """Create a new object for handling a set of specific catalogs. 

267 

268 Catalogs are loaded according a set of filters : the accepted and 

269 rejected pattern. 

270 

271 Note: 

272 ----- 

273 The `extra_directories` parameter can be given as input in order to 

274 load catalogs in other directories. a list of directories is expected 

275 for `extra_directories` parameter. For example: 

276 

277 ``` 

278 GWCatalogs.create( 

279 GWCatalogType.UCB, 

280 "/tmp", 

281 "*.h5", 

282 "*chain*", 

283 extra_direcories=[".", "./tutorial"] 

284 ) 

285 ``` 

286 

287 Args: 

288 type (GWCatalogType.GWCatalogPlugin): Type of catalog 

289 directory (str) : Directory where the data are located 

290 accepted_pattern (str, optional) : pattern to select files in the 

291 directory (e.g. '*.h5'). Default None 

292 rejected_pattern (str, optional) : pattern to reject from the list 

293 built using accepted_pattern. Default None 

294 

295 Returns: 

296 GWCatalogs: the object implementing a set of specific catalogs 

297 """ 

298 module = importlib.import_module(type.module_name) 

299 my_class = getattr(module, type.class_name) 

300 arguments = [directory] 

301 if accepted_pattern is not None: 

302 arguments.append(accepted_pattern) 

303 if rejected_pattern is not None: 

304 arguments.append(rejected_pattern) 

305 return my_class(*arguments, *args, **kwargs)
